Our Approach
Support That Moves Your Mission Forward.
Discovery & Discussion
We take the time to truly understand your organization, including your mission, your goals, and your unique challenges. This allows us to build a clear path forward together.
Research & Strategy
Using our trusted network of hundreds of private foundations, public grant programs, family foundations, corporate foundations, and more, we match your work with funding sources that align with your values and vision.
Proposal Development
We craft compelling grant stories that highlight the best of your work while making sure every proposal aligns perfectly with your funder’s priorities.
Compliance & Support
Our team provides the steady support you need to meet every grant requirement and set your organization up for years of success.
